Volatility is the degree of change in an asset’s price – if a market is highly volatile, it means that there are big price swings, while a market with low volatility is comparatively stable. Momentum trading is the practice of buying and selling assets according to the recent strength of price trends. It is based on the idea that if there is enough force behind a price move, it will continue to move in the same direction. The Momentum Indicator in Swing Trading

The term momentum was borrowed from Newton’s first law of motion. The law states that where an object in motion tends to stay in motion until an external force is applied to it. Like in the law of physics, a market in motion tends to stay in motion rather than reverse. This is the reason why a momentum indicator strategy is so powerful. What is the best indicator for momentum?

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D)

Often regarded as the best momentum indicator, MACD is a trend-following indicator. It represents the relationship between 2 moving averages of a financial instrument's price. MACD moves back and forth between moving averages and indicates momentum.

Oscillators are a good tool for determining overbought or oversold conditions and give us a warning that the price trend is overextended and vulnerable. Does momentum indicator work in forex?

The Momentum indicator can be used to provide trade signals, but it is better used to help forex traders confirm the validity of trades based on price action such as breakouts or pullbacks.

Momentum indicators, such as RSI and Stochastic, are favorite indicators for non-trending markets. Momentum indicators ideally gauge whether the market is overbought or oversold during its non-trending state, and highlight potential reversal points before those actually occur. What is an example of momentum indicator?

Using indicators of this type, traders can identify leading momentum trading signals. They seek to understand if the market is overbought or oversold at close and if it could be about to change direction. Examples of these momentum indicators include the Relative Strength Index (RSI) and the Rate of Change (ROC).
